Dr. Ogadimma Mgbajah is the first female cardiothoracic surgeon in Nig and West Africa.
She hails from Owerri, Imo State, attended the Fed Govt Girls College, Calabar, Cross River State and was the only female graduate of her class at the Uni College Hospital, Ibadan in 2005.
